Fanatec Wheel Stand with QR2 Quick Release Mount (2023 QR2)

Description

Due to Rewbin asking over at my Fanatec QR Wheel Stand in the comments ... He also provided time and effort to test-print the model iterations and gave great feedback, thanks!

I edited my QR1 stand to work with the new 2023 QR2 quick release mechanism.

I've tried to maintain the original dimensions/positions to make it still fit in one piece on the build plate.

But please note: I am unable to test it properly for myself as I do not own a QR2 wheel and base.

UPDATE 2023-11-06 (v3)

Key features/improvements:

  • tested high quality model of the mount stub from Spiesel, thanks very much for allowing the remix!
  • more protruding legs so heavier/front-heavy wheels don't tipple over

single-part/two-part versions:

  • one-part for smaller build plates, which will support smaller wheels (about 15 cm from center to bottom)
  • two-part variant you'll have to glue together for bigger wheels (about 19 cm from center to bottom) and/or use a self-tapping wood screw, whatever works best for you

As this is a functional part and the wheel can be heavy, take this into account when choosing your filament, number of perimeters and infill percentage.

Mine from almost 4 years ago (obviously QR1, not QR2) is still fine using PLA with 3 perimeters and 20% infill though, but your mileage may vary.
